WebbChromosome 21 is the smallest human chromosome, spanning about 48 million base pairs (the building blocks of DNA) and representing 1.5 to 2 percent of the total DNA in cells. WebbThe smallest gene (s) are the tRNA's that are 76 base pairs long. This answer was given by Shawn Burgess, PhD. Dystrophin is a rod-shaped cytoplasmic protein located primarily in skeletal muscles and cardiac muscles. Humans, for instance, have 46 chromosomes in a typical body cell (somatic cell), while dogs have 78 ^1 1.
